What is Cosmetology

Benjamin TX hair stylist cutting hairCosmetology is a profession that is everything about making the human body look more attractive through the application of cosmetics. So of course it makes sense that numerous cosmetology schools are described as beauty schools. Most of us think of makeup when we hear the word cosmetics, but actually a cosmetic can be anything that enhances the look of a person’s skin, hair or nails. If you want to work as a cosmetologist, almost all states mandate that you undergo some type of specialized training and then become licensed. Once licensed, the work settings include not only Benjamin TX beauty salons and barber shops, but also such venues as spas, hotels and resorts. Many cosmetologists, once they have gotten experience and a client base, launch their own shops or salons. Others will start servicing clients either in their own residences or will travel to the client’s house, or both. Cosmetology college graduates go by many titles and work in a wide range of specialties including:

  • Hairdressers
  • Hairstylists
  • Beauticians
  • Barbers
  • Manicurists
  • Nail Technicians
  • Makeup Artists
  • Hair Coloring Specialists
  • Estheticians
  • Electrolysis Technicians

As previously mentioned, in most states working cosmetologists must be licensed. In certain states there is an exception. Only those offering more skilled services, such as hairstylists, are required to be licensed. Others employed in cosmetology and less skilled, such as shampooers, are not required to become licensed in those states.

Cosmetologist Certificates and Degrees

nail techs training at Benjamin TX beauty schoolThere are basically two pathways available to obtain cosmetology training and a credential upon completion. You can enroll in a certificate (or diploma) program, or you can pursue an Associate’s degree. Certificate programs typically require 12 to 18 months to finish, while an Associate’s degree ordinarily takes about 2 years. If you enroll in a certificate program you will be trained in each of the major areas of cosmetology. Briefer programs are available if you prefer to focus on just one area, for instance hair coloring. A degree program will also likely feature management and marketing training to ensure that graduates are better prepared to run a parlor or other Benjamin TX business. More advanced degrees are not prevalent, but Bachelor and Master’s degree programs are available in such specialties as salon or spa management. Whatever type of program you opt for, it’s essential to make sure that it’s certified by the Texas Board of Cosmetology. Many states only recognize schools that are accredited by certain reputable organizations, for example the American Association of Cosmetology Schools (AACS). We will examine the benefits of accreditation for the school you decide on in the upcoming segment.

Online Cosmetologist Programs

student attending online beauty school in Benjamin TXOnline beauty schools are convenient for Benjamin TX students who are working full time and have family commitments that make it hard to enroll in a more traditional school. There are many online cosmetology school programs available that can be accessed via a desktop computer or laptop at the student’s convenience. More conventional beauty schools are often fast paced given that many programs are as brief as 6 or 8 months. This means that a large amount of time is spent in the classroom. With online programs, you are dealing with the same volume of material, but you’re not spending numerous hours outside of your home or travelling to and from classes. On the other hand, it’s vital that the program you pick can provide internship training in area salons and parlors in order that you also obtain the hands-on training necessary for a complete education. Without the internship portion of the training, it’s difficult to obtain the skills required to work in any area of the cosmetology profession. So don’t forget if you choose to enroll in an online program to confirm that internship training is available in your area.

What to Ask Cosmetologist Training Programs

Questions to ask Benjamin TX cosmetology schoolsBelow is a list of questions that you will want to investigate for any cosmetologist training program you are contemplating. As we have already discussed, the location of the school relative to your Benjamin TX home, together with the expense of tuition, will most likely be your first qualifiers. Whether you would like to pursue a certificate, diploma or a degree will undoubtedly be next on your list. But once you have reduced your school options based on those initial qualifications, there are additional factors that you must research and take into consideration before enrolling in a cosmetology program. Below we have put together some of those additional questions that you need to ask each school before making a final decision.

Is the Program Accredited? It’s essential to make sure that the cosmetology school you select is accredited. The accreditation should be by a U.S. Department of Education recognized local or national agency, such as the National Accrediting Commission for Cosmetology Arts & Sciences (NACCAS). Schools accredited by the NACCAS must comply with their high standards ensuring a quality curriculum and education. Accreditation can also be necessary for getting student loans or financial aid, which typically are not obtainable in 79505 for non- accredited schools. It’s also a requirement for licensing in several states that the training be accredited. And as a concluding benefit, many Benjamin TX businesses will not employ recent graduates of non-accredited schools, or may look more favorably upon those with accredited training.

Does the School have a Good Reputation?  Every cosmetology institute that you are seriously considering should have a good to excellent reputation within the profession. Being accredited is an excellent beginning. Next, ask the schools for references from their network of businesses where they have referred their students. Confirm that the schools have high job placement rates, indicating that their students are highly regarded. Check rating companies for reviews as well as the school’s accrediting agencies. If you have any connections with Benjamin TX salon owners or managers, or any person working in the field, ask them if they are familiar with the schools you are reviewing. They may even be able to recommend others that you had not considered. And finally, contact the Texas school licensing authority to find out if there have been any grievances filed or if the schools are in full compliance.

What’s the School’s Focus?  A number of cosmetology schools offer programs that are comprehensive in nature, focusing on all facets of cosmetology. Others are more focused, providing training in a specific specialty, such as hairstyling, manicuring or electrolysis. Schools that offer degree programs frequently broaden into a management and marketing curriculum. So it’s imperative that you choose a school that focuses on your area of interest. If your intention is to be trained as an esthetician, make sure that the school you enroll in is accredited and respected for that program. If your desire is to start a hair salon in Benjamin TX, then you need to enroll in a degree program that will instruct you how to be an owner/operator. Selecting a highly ranked school with a weak program in the specialty you are pursuing will not provide the training you require.

Is Any Live Training Provided?  Studying and perfecting cosmetology skills and techniques involves lots of practice on people. Ask how much live, hands-on training is included in the beauty courses you will be attending. A number of schools have salons on site that allow students to practice their developing skills on volunteers. If a beauty academy offers limited or no scheduled live training, but rather depends mainly on utilizing mannequins, it may not be the best alternative for cultivating your skills. Therefore look for alternate schools that offer this kind of training.

Does the School Provide Job Assistance?  When a student graduates from a beauty program, it’s imperative that she or he receives help in finding that very first job. Job placement programs are an important part of that process. Schools that provide help maintain relationships with Benjamin TX employers that are searching for trained graduates available for hiring. Check that the programs you are looking at have job placement programs and ask which salons and businesses they refer students to. Additionally, find out what their job placement rates are. Higher rates not only verify that they have broad networks of employers, but that their programs are highly regarded as well.

Is Financial Assistance Available?  The majority of beauty schools provide financial aid or student loan assistance for their students. Ask if the schools you are investigating have a financial aid department. Consult with a counselor and find out what student loans or grants you may qualify for. If the school is a member of the American Association of Cosmetology Schools (AACS), it will have scholarships available to students as well. If a school fulfills each of your other qualifications except for cost, do not omit it as an option before you determine what financial help may be available.

Benjamin, Texas

The community was founded in 1884 by Hilory G. Bedford, president and controlling stockholder in the Wichita and Brazos Stock Company. He named it Benjamin after his son, who had been killed by lightning.[4][5] To attract additional settlers, Bedford gave his stockholders a 50-acre tract of land and set aside 40 more acres for a town square. Benjamin was designed as the Knox County seat when it was organized in 1886. A school opened in 1886, as well. A jail built in 1887 still stands as a private residence and the old bank stands next to the sheriff's office.[5] Benjamin was incorporated in 1928 and the population was 485 in the 1930 census.[4] Two structures in the community, a courthouse (1938) and school building (1942), were constructed with Works Projects Administration labor. That courthouse replaced the previous stone structure built in 1888. The number of inhabitants reached a high of 599 in 1940, but that figure slowly decreased during the latter half of the 20th century.

As of the census[1] of 2000, 264 people, 97 households, and 64 families resided in the city. The population density was 254.5 people per square mile (98.0/km2). The 119 housing units averaged 114.7 per square mile (44.2/km2). The racial makeup of the city was 89.77% White, 3.03% African American, 1.89% Asian, 4.92% from other races, and 0.38% from two or more races. Hispanics or Latinos of any race were 11.36% of the population.

Of the 97 households, 36.1% had children under the age of 18 living with them, 48.5% were married couples living together, 14.4% had a female householder with no husband present, and 33.0% were not families; 30.9% of all households were made up of individuals, and 19.6% had someone living alone who was 65 years of age or older. The average household size was 2.59 and the average family size was 3.31.
